You'll also need to check the language requirements. Most courses are taught in German, requiring international applicants to submit proof of proficiency in the German language. Two main tests are available for this purpose: the Deutsche Sprachprfung for then Hochschulzugang (DSH, meaning Germanlanguage examination for university entrance) and the Test DaF. Likewise, if your course is taught in English, unless you are a native speaker or have previously studied in English, you will need to prove your knowledge of the language with a test such as IELTS or TOEFL. Universities will usually state the score/s they require on their websites.

The IITs prepared nine rank lists caste and reservation wise including general, OBC, SC, ST, PWD category. Last year, a general category student was required to score a minimum of 75 marks of 372 to get a rank. It was 67 marks for OBC applicants and 38 for SC/ Category candidates.
